Medical Billing and Coding Specialist Salary in San Ramon, CA: $35,042 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time medical billing and coding specialist in San Ramon, CA earns a median $35,042/year (≈ $16.84/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-2072). Once you factor in San Ramon's price level (13% above national, BEA RPP 113.1), that paycheck buys what $30,983 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 0.1% below the California state average.
Based on BLS state-level estimates · View source

The projected median annual salary for medical billing and coding specialists in San Ramon, CA, is $35,042 for 2026, indicating a notable increase compared to the national median of $30,349. This local pay figure falls within a salary range from $24,583 at the lower end (P10) to $54,315 at the higher end (P90). Such forecasts are derived from 2025 BLS data and adjusted to reflect regional price variations. In San Ramon, specialized roles that require coding for inpatient services generally offer higher compensation than those focused on outpatient coding or risk adjustment. This is reflective of both local market demands and the unique skill sets needed for different coding environments.

Medical Billing and Coding Specialist Job Market in San Ramon
Analysts predict stable growth of 2.32% annually in this field, with 19 medical billing and coding specialists already employed in San Ramon. Although the local cost of living index stands at 113.1, which is above the national average, it affects take-home salaries and purchasing power for these specialists. Employers that typically offer higher pay include hospital inpatient coding departments and third-party coding companies, with positions in physician group practice coding often being competitive as well. Factors driving the wage disparity include subspecialties, where inpatient CCS roles tend to surpass others in remuneration. Furthermore, credential stacking (CPC plus CCS and CRC), productivity-based bonuses, and the growing trend of remote work can significantly influence earnings. Aspiring professionals might consider pursuing additional certifications and skills in risk adjustment and remote coding to maximize their earning potential in the San Ramon market.
